2016 - 2024

感恩一路有你

仿真与模拟的区别

浏览量:2848 时间:2024-08-06 13:25:46 作者:采采

1. 定义

仿真(Simulation)是指通过对现实对象或系统进行模型建立和仿真运行,模拟真实场景,以实现对系统行为、性能等方面的研究和评估。

而模拟(Emulation)则是指用一个物理系统或软件来模拟另一个系统的行为、功能和接口。模拟通常用于测试和验证硬件与软件之间的兼容性。

2. 对象

仿真通常应用于复杂系统或过程的研究,如飞行器、交通系统、天气模拟等。它可以提供更真实的环境和情境,让研究者能够在仿真环境中探索不同的策略和决策。

而模拟则主要用于测试和验证,比如在计算机硬件开发过程中,使用模拟器来模拟真实的硬件环境,以便进行功能测试和性能评估。

3. 精度

仿真追求较高的精确度和真实性,以保证结果的可靠性和可信度。它需要准确地模拟各种因素和变量,以尽可能接近真实情况。

模拟相对而言更加简化和抽象,重点是模拟被测试系统的核心功能和接口。它不一定需要完全还原真实环境,只要能够验证系统的基本功能就可以了。

4. 应用

仿真广泛应用于科学研究、工程设计和决策支持等领域。在科学研究中,仿真可以帮助研究人员理解和预测复杂系统的行为。在工程设计中,仿真可以用于测试不同的设计方案,优化系统性能。

而模拟主要应用于硬件和软件的测试和验证。在硬件开发中,模拟器可以帮助开发人员进行功能测试和性能评估。在软件开发中,模拟器可以模拟不同的操作系统和设备环境,以验证软件的兼容性。

5. 结论

综上所述,仿真和模拟虽然有一定的相似之处,但其应用场景、目标和精度都存在差异。在选择使用时,需根据具体需求权衡利弊,并确定合适的方法来满足需求。

新仿真与模拟的区别及应用领域

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。